Johnson & Johnson's brands include numerous household names of medications and first aid supplies. Johnson & Johnson had worldwide sales of $93.8 billion during the calendar year 2021. The corporation includes some 250 subsidiary companies with operations in 60 countries and products sold in over 175 countries. Johnson & Johnson is headquartered in New Brunswick, New Jersey, the consumer division being located in Skillman, New Jersey. Johnson & Johnson is one of the world's most valuable companies, and is one of only two U.S.-based companies that has a prime credit rating of AAA, higher than that of the United States government. 36 on the 2021 Fortune 500 list of the largest United States corporations by total revenue.
